Output 6ece86fade42362f13a9b0743fefde198d1fa2fe757fb5d82ce88b8ce1734c74:1

value
6975216354832
script pubkey
OP_0 OP_PUSHBYTES_20 d77527fc88562f56ca0cf690eb3cb59e5de07d1e
address
tb1q6a6j0lyg2ch4djsv76gwk094new7qlg7pnxfdd
transaction
6ece86fade42362f13a9b0743fefde198d1fa2fe757fb5d82ce88b8ce1734c74
confirmations
184084
spent
true